Should I buy a Birkin from Fashionphile or Madison Avenue Couture?

Fashionphile vs Madison Avenue Couture

Madison Avenue Couture is often useful when a buyer wants deeper Hermès-specialist inventory, rare colors, exotics, or pristine collector specs. Fashionphile is useful as a large resale-market benchmark. The right choice is the listing with the strongest condition evidence, accessories, merchant terms, and price relative to comparable live Birkins.

Buyer Questions

Is Madison Avenue Couture better than Fashionphile?

It depends on the listing. Madison Avenue Couture often has deeper Hermès-specialist inventory, while Fashionphile is a broader resale marketplace.

Which should I use for rare Birkins?

Check Madison Avenue Couture, Love Luxury, and specialist boutiques first, then compare any Fashionphile listing that matches the spec.

What matters most on a high-price Birkin?

Condition, provenance, accessories, authentication language, photos, return terms, and comparable live pricing.
